WAIKATO COUNTY COUNCIL.
TilK ordinary meeting and the last of the present Council met yesterday in the Council Chambers, Hamilton Hast. Present : Messrs Primrose (chairman), Furze, Gordon, Mcurs, Seddon, Thomas, and Bailey.
ConUEsros hence —A letter was read from Mr F. XV. Lang, M.H.K., offering to represent tlio Councils included in his constituency at the County Council's Conference.—lt was decided to thaok Mr Lang, but to inform him that the Council saw no good to be arrived at by representation. Model Fak.m Lease.—The Clerk intimated that the lease, had not been signed by the lessees, whose tender had been accepted.—He was instructed lo make application for a quarter's rent from the tenderers, as they had put cattle upon the land.
Komokohau Bkidge, No. I.—Or. Cordon handed in a letter from Mr Worthington in reference to No. 1 Bridge, Komokorau. Mr Worthington had examined the bridge at the request of Cr. Cordon, and reported that it required sundry repairs, and that the bridge had taken a cant down stream. Cr, Cordon had made a calculation that the timber required for tiie necessary repairs would cost about £4O, —It was agreed to call tenders for the work, Mr Worthington and Cr. Gordon to draw the specifications, the latter to receive the tenders. Jeyfkey's Bkiimjk. -Cr. Meats reported that this bridge required repairs. —lt was arranged that Cr. .Meats should examine the bridge and report particulars. Disqualified Ratkiwykks. The Clerk reported that 2.">0 ratepayers are disqualified from voting at ttie coining e'ection for not having paid t'ac'r rates at all, or not having paid before 00th June last.
